Cefpodoxime Tablets

Formulated to alleviate bacterial infections, this medication is indicated to support the management of respiratory and urinary system pathogens.

Strengths: 100 · 200mg

Medicine details

Alternative names

Orelox

Therapeutic class

Cephalosporin antibiotic

Pharmacological class

3rd generation cephalosporin

Contraindications

hypersensitivity to cephalosporins

Precautions and warnings

complete the full course; monitor for allergic reactions

Minor side effects

diarrhoea; nausea; abdominal pain

Moderate side effects

headache; dizziness

Dosage forms

Film-coated tablet

Administration route

Oral use

Prescription status

POM

Manufacturer

Sanofi

Onset Time

1–2 hours

Duration

12 hours

Storage instructions

Store at room temperature in a dry place.

Drug interactions

antacids

Age restrictions

Use strictly as prescribed.

Pregnancy and breastfeeding

Use with medical consultation.

Serious side effects

pseudomembranous colitis — requires immediate medical attention; anaphylaxis — requires immediate medical attention

Mechanism of action

Cefpodoxime is a third-generation cephalosporin. It functions by inhibiting bacterial cell wall synthesis through the disruption of transpeptidation, which prevents the bacteria from creating a stable structure, resulting in cell death.
